5568bd4c16 UnitMotion - Explicit handling of movement errors (such as target death) in Combat.Approaching
In A23, units that are approaching an enemy (Combat.Approaching) will
carry on moving to their last waypoint if the target dies, and then go
idle.
As of 69d3e76fd2, this no longer happens and units stop in their tracks,
staying in attacking forever.

This lets Combat.Approaching explicitly handle the error, deciding what
is best to do:
- go to the next order (for hunting and queued orders)
- find new targets nearby (in case the attack wasn't a forced order)
- walk to the target's last known position and find units to attack
there (in case it was). This is A23 behaviour.

44aef27b78 Adapt unitMotion to edge-edge distance checks.
D981/c219ee54b2 changed IsInXChecks to use edge-to-edge distance instead
of centre-to-edge, which broke UnitMotion's min-range movement, which
assumed distance to the center.

Since units are represented as squares, the diagonal point may be closer
to the target than the "real" clearance by a factor √2, so the delta
between minimum range and maximum range should be at least `(√2 - 1) *
clearance` to be safe in all situations (this is generally not a problem
for regular units which have a clearance of 0.8, but could be one for
catapults or elephants).

69d3e76fd2 Unit Motion - Stop when targets have an invalid position.
Previously, unitMotion had no code that checked particularly if the
target was still in the world.
When the target moved out of the world, unitMotion would follow the path
to its last known position, then send a "MoveSucceeded" message once
there.

Following 98f609df1d, this message was no longer sent. Thus unit would
follow their path to its last waypoint and stay there, unable to carry
on or finish the order. UnitMotion now explcitly sends a "MoveFailed"
message.

This still changes behaviour from A23, requiring further revisions to
UnitAI (see D1992 for one such case).

190f8d3566 Calculate entity limit counts correctly when SpawnUnits fails in ProductionQueue.
When adding a batch of unit, these in-training units get added to the
production queue and to the entity limit count.
These in-training units need to be removed from the entity limit counts
when spawning them, or we would be double-counting them. This was done
when creating the cached entities, but this was too early: entities
might fail to spawn, for example when there is no room around the
foundation.

Change that so the entity limit count is now decremented right before
giving spawned entities the correct owner (which triggers EntityLimits
OnGlobalOwnershipChanged, which adds the spawned entities to the entity
limit count).

Additionally, add Init to TrainingRestrictions so that the test setup
doesn't complain. Other components have an empty Init instead of
checking for Init in the test setup (and 61/67 have an Init function) so
it seems more standard this way.

8ac104b07a Fix 'gliding' behaviour at the end of movement by moving the PossiblyAtDestination check earlier.
Units in 0 A.D. exhibited a "gliding" behaviour at the end of a
movement, e.g. they switched to the Idle animation and still moved a
little bit.

The reason for this behaviour is that entities check if they reached
their destination after moving. Other components (unitAI mostly) will
then possibly change animations and such, resulting in a movement over
the turn while the entity is possibly now in another animation state
than "move".
Instead, what should be done is checking if the entity has arrived
before moving, so if UnitAI calls StopMoving, then entity won't move at
all on the same turn, and the gliding effect vanishes.

The STATE_STOPPING state is made un-necessary by this change, since this
off-by-one mistake was the reason for its existence. It can be removed
(see downstream).

f04bdd84ae UnitMotion - Split Move() into several functions
Move() is generally 4 parts:
- Moving
- Updating our state
- Handling obstructed moves
- Checking if we are at destination.

These can all be put in their own functions, clarifying logic and making
it harder to make mistakes.
